Women choose to wear dresses for various reasons, and it's important to note that not all women wear dresses every day. However, for those who do, there are several factors that influence this choice.
Comfort and Ease
Dresses are often preferred for their comfort and ease of wear. They typically offer more freedom of movement compared to other types of clothing, such as pants or skirts with separate tops. Dresses for women are one-piece garments that can be easily slipped on, requiring less time and effort to put together an outfit.
Feminine Expression
Dresses have traditionally been associated with femininity and are often worn as a way to express one's personal style and embrace their femininity. They can make women feel elegant, graceful, and confident, allowing them to showcase their individuality and enhance their self-image.
Cultural and Societal Norms
In many cultures, dresses have been a traditional form of attire for women. Societal expectations and norms also play a role in influencing women's clothing choices. In some settings, wearing dresses may be seen as more appropriate or formal, especially in professional or social events.
Fashion and Aesthetics
Dresses come in a wide range of styles, colours, and patterns, offering endless possibilities for fashion experimentation and personal expression. Women may choose to wear dresses to showcase their sense of style, follow current fashion trends, or simply because they find dresses visually appealing. Climate and Practicality
Dresses can be a practical choice in warm climates or during the summer months when they offer better ventilation and breathability compared to pants or jeans. Additionally, some dresses are designed with practical features such as pockets, making them a convenient choice for carrying small items.
Important To Recognize
It's important to recognize that individual preferences and motivations for wearing dresses may vary greatly. While some women may choose to wear dresses every day for the reasons mentioned above, others may prefer different types of clothing based on personal style, cultural background, or practical considerations. Fashion choices are ultimately a matter of personal expression and comfort.
